  21. CF re-named all of the DC Comics (owned by Warner Brothers) and SF names of rides when it purchased SFWOA. Hence, it is logical it will do the same with all of PP. However, since it has the option of using the license for a number of years - when the changes will be made is questionable. Have a great day! Italian Chef
